Om man kollar på databladen för PIC12Fxxx så heter portarna GA.0 osv, men på PIC16Fxxx heter dom RA.0 osv..
Finns det någon anledning till det?
Man skriver väll "PORTA.0" för PIC12 serien också..?
RA /GA ?
- bengt-re
- EF Sponsor
- Inlägg: 4829
- Blev medlem: 4 april 2005, 16:18:59
- Skype: bengt-re
- Ort: Söder om söder
- Kontakt:
Tja, portaren på Pic12F629 heter GPIO, på större picar hetar portarna PORTA, PORTB och så vidare - därav namnen. Tror att man valde namnet GPIO istället för PORTA för att korrrolera bättre med gamla 12-bitars 12Cxxx även om pic 12f629 är baserad på 14-bitars kärnan och egentligen borde hetat 16F629....
Microchiplogik i ett nötskal....
Saknar du 12-bitars kärnarn så finns 10F fortfarande kvar

Saknar du 12-bitars kärnarn så finns 10F fortfarande kvar

> Finns det någon anledning till det?
De måste ju heta *något*.
> Man skriver väll "PORTA.0" för PIC12 serien också..?
Det fungerar mycket bättre att göra som databladet säger
och att använda de symboler som t.ex P12F629.INC definierar.
Annars får du lägga ner en massa tid på egna helt onödiga anpassningar.
De måste ju heta *något*.
> Man skriver väll "PORTA.0" för PIC12 serien också..?
Det fungerar mycket bättre att göra som databladet säger
och att använda de symboler som t.ex P12F629.INC definierar.
Annars får du lägga ner en massa tid på egna helt onödiga anpassningar.